How to Support a Healthy Prostate Naturally Without Prescription Drugs

Maintaining prostate health is essential for men, especially as they age. The prostate gland plays a crucial role in reproductive health and urinary function. While prescription medications can be helpful for certain prostate issues, many individuals prefer natural alternatives. Here’s how to support a healthy prostate naturally.

A well-balanced diet is foundational for overall health, including prostate health. Consuming a diet rich in fruits, vegetables, whole grains, and healthy fats can provide essential nutrients that promote prostate health. Foods that are particularly beneficial include tomatoes, which are high in lycopene—an antioxidant linked to reduced prostate cancer risk. Cruciferous vegetables such as broccoli, cauliflower, and Brussels sprouts may also help maintain healthy prostate function due to their high levels of vitamins and phytonutrients.

Incorporating more omega-3 fatty acids into your diet can also be beneficial. These healthy fats can be found in fatty fish like salmon, mackerel, and sardines as well as in flaxseeds and walnuts. Omega-3 fatty acids have anti-inflammatory properties that may help reduce inflammation in the prostate and promote overall health.

Hydration is another critical factor for maintaining a healthy prostate. Drinking plenty of water throughout the day helps flush out toxins and supports healthy urinary function. However, it’s essential to balance fluid intake, especially in the evening, to avoid frequent nighttime trips to the bathroom.

Regular physical activity is a vital component of a healthy lifestyle and can have a profound impact on prostate health. Exercise helps maintain a healthy weight and reduces the risk of developing prostate issues. Activities like walking, jogging, cycling, and swimming are excellent ways to promote cardiovascular health while benefiting the prostate. Moreover, engaging in resistance training can improve hormone levels and support overall well-being.

Stress management is often overlooked but is incredibly important for prostate health. Chronic stress can lead to hormonal imbalances and negatively impact overall health. Techniques such as yoga, meditation, and deep-breathing exercises can reduce stress levels and promote relaxation. Engaging in hobbies, spending time with loved ones, and ensuring adequate sleep also contribute to managing stress.

In addition to dietary and lifestyle changes, certain natural supplements may support prostate health. One such option is saw palmetto, a plant extract that has been shown to help alleviate symptoms of benign prostatic hyperplasia (BPH) and support urinary function. Similarly, beta-sitosterol, a plant-derived compound, may relieve symptoms associated with BPH and contribute to overall prostate health.

Always consult with a healthcare professional before starting any new supplement to ensure it aligns with your individual health needs.

Maintaining a healthy weight is also crucial for supporting prostate health. Obesity has been linked to an increased risk of prostate cancer and other urinary issues. By focusing on a nutritious diet and regular physical activity, men can manage their weight effectively and reduce their chances of developing prostate problems.

Finally, regular check-ups with a healthcare professional can help monitor prostate health. Screening for prostate issues can lead to early detection and better management of any potential problems.

By making conscious choices regarding diet, exercise, and stress management, men can naturally support their prostate health without relying solely on prescription medications. While the journey to optimal prostate health may require commitment and lifestyle changes, the benefits of taking a proactive approach can result in improved quality of life and overall well-being.

    Best Weight Management Habits for Busy Adults

    In today’s fast-paced world, maintaining a healthy weight can be a significant challenge, especially for busy adults balancing work, family, and personal commitments. However, adopting effective weight management habits can make a substantial difference, helping you achieve your health goals without feeling overwhelmed. Here are some of the best practices for busy adults looking to manage their weight effectively.

    **Prioritize Meal Planning**

    One of the most effective strategies for weight management is meal planning. By dedicating a few hours each week to prepare your meals, you can avoid the temptation of last-minute unhealthy food choices. Create a weekly menu that includes a variety of whole foods—fruits, vegetables, lean proteins, and whole grains. Preparing meals in advance allows you to control portion sizes and ingredients, making it easier to stick to a healthy diet amid a hectic schedule.

    **Stay Hydrated**

    Water is often overlooked when it comes to weight management. Drinking enough water throughout the day can help control hunger, boost metabolism, and promote overall health. Busy adults should aim to carry a reusable water bottle and set reminders to drink regularly, especially during work hours. Sometimes, feelings of hunger can be confused with thirst, so staying hydrated can prevent unnecessary snacking.

    **Incorporate Movement Into Your Day**

    For busy adults, finding time to exercise can be daunting. However, incorporating physical activity into your daily routine can help burn calories and manage weight. Look for opportunities to move more—take the stairs instead of the elevator, walk during your lunch break, or do a quick home workout. Even short bouts of activity can add up significantly over the week. Aim for at least 150 minutes of moderate aerobic activity or 75 minutes of vigorous activity each week, broken down into manageable sessions that fit your schedule.

    **Mindful Eating**

    In the chaos of daily life, eating can often become a mindless activity. Practicing mindful eating, where you pay full attention to the eating experience, can help you develop a healthier relationship with food. Take the time to savor each bite, and listen to your body’s hunger and fullness cues. Avoid distractions such as phones or television during meals to enhance awareness of what and how much you are eating. This practice can lead to more satisfying meals and prevent overeating.

    **Set Realistic Goals**

    Setting realistic and achievable weight management goals is crucial for busy adults. Instead of aiming for rapid weight loss, focus on making small, sustainable changes that fit into your lifestyle. Goals like losing 1-2 pounds per week are attainable and can lead to lasting results. Additionally, celebrate your successes along the way, no matter how small. Recognizing accomplishments can boost your motivation to continue on your weight management journey.

    **Get Support**

    Having a support system can significantly impact your weight management journey. Whether it’s friends, family, or a community group, sharing your goals and progress with others can provide encouragement and accountability. Consider joining a weight management program or an online forum where you can connect with others facing similar challenges. This sense of belonging can make a big difference in staying committed to your goals.

    why am i always bloated even when i eat clean

    Feeling bloated can be frustrating, especially if you’re committed to eating clean and living a healthy lifestyle. Many individuals who focus on nutritious diets often find themselves battling a seemingly constant state of abdominal discomfort and swelling. Understanding the reasons behind this bloating can help you find relief and enhance your overall wellness.

    One of the primary culprits of bloating is food intolerances. Even healthy foods can cause digestive disturbances in certain individuals. Common foods that may lead to bloating include dairy, gluten, and certain types of fibers. If you’ve recently incorporated more whole grains, legumes, or cruciferous vegetables into your diet, it could be worth examining if they are the source of your discomfort. Keeping a food diary can help you identify patterns and pinpoint any potential offenders.

    Another factor to consider is how you eat. Eating too quickly can result in swallowing excess air, which can lead to bloating. When you’re busy or distracted, you might not chew your food properly, making it harder for your digestive system to break it down. This can also lead to overeating, as it takes about 20 minutes for your brain to register fullness. Implementing mindful eating practices—such as taking small bites, chewing thoroughly, and paying attention to your hunger cues—can significantly alleviate bloating.

    Your hydration levels can also play a crucial role in how your body processes food. Insufficient water intake can disrupt your digestive system, causing constipation and bloating. Conversely, drinking excessive amounts of carbonated beverages can introduce gas into your system, contributing to that uncomfortable feeling. It’s vital to find the right balance.     Stress and anxiety can also manifest physically in numerous ways, including bloating. When you experience stress, your body goes into fight-or-flight mode, and your digestive system may slow down. Tension can lead to muscle tightness in your abdomen and hinder proper digestion. Incorporating stress-reducing techniques such as yoga, meditation, or deep breathing exercises into your daily routine can help ease your stress levels and, in turn, promote better digestion.

    Additionally, hormonal changes can have a significant impact on stomach bloating. Many women experience bloating as a side effect of their menstrual cycle, often due to fluctuations in hormones like progesterone and estrogen. This type of bloating is usually temporary and subsides once the cycle progresses. Keeping track of your cycle can help you anticipate these fluctuations and prepare for them.

    Overeating, even healthy foods, can lead to discomfort. Practicing portion control can help manage this issue. Eating smaller, more frequent meals can also keep your digestive system active and prevent the sensation of being overly full.

    Lastly, it’s important to consider your physical activity levels. Regular exercise helps keep your digestive system moving and can aid in alleviating bloating. Incorporating both cardiovascular exercises and strengthening workouts into your routine can help stimulate digestion. Simple activities like walking after meals can encourage gut motility and reduce bloating.

    In conclusion, if you’re experiencing persistent bloating despite eating clean, it’s essential to look beyond your diet. Understanding food intolerances, practicing mindful eating, managing stress, and staying active are all vital steps in addressing this common issue. Take note of how your body reacts to different foods and situations, and be open to adjustments in your routine. Your journey to feeling comfortable in your own skin may require some trial and error, but with mindful attention, you can find a path to relief.
